Các phân vùng GPT có ít bị hỏng hơn các phân vùng dựa trên MBR không?


28

Phân vùng GPT (Bảng phân vùng GUID) có một số lợi ích so với MBR (Bản ghi khởi động chính), bao gồm Hỗ trợ cho:

  1. Thêm phân vùng (128)
  2. Ổ đĩa lớn hơn 2 TB

Nhưng có bất kỳ lợi ích khác như ít khả năng tham nhũng? (Hai lỗi HD tôi gặp phải là MBR bị hỏng). Hay bạn chỉ đang chơi wack-a-mol trong đó GPT sau đó bị hỏng theo cùng một cách?


2
Tại sao tham nhũng xảy ra ngay từ đầu? Có phải chỉ là các ngành khác có thể bị hỏng mà không bị phát hiện?
pjc50

Câu trả lời:


35

Theo Wikipedia , có sự dư thừa trong sơ đồ GPT. Bảng GPT được ghi ở đầu đĩa, cũng như ở cuối đĩa (xem hình ảnh). Ngoài ra, mỗi bảng GPT có tổng kiểm tra CRC32.

nhập mô tả hình ảnh ở đây

Dự phòng không có sẵn trong lược đồ MBR (chỉ chiếm 512 byte đầu tiên của đĩa). Sự dư thừa thêm sẽ cho phép khả năng phục hồi chống tham nhũng nhiều hơn. Tổng kiểm tra CRC32 cho phép hệ thống phát hiện bảng nào trong hai bảng là bảng chính xác được sử dụng để sửa chữa bảng khác.


1
Tôi tự hỏi tại sao họ không đi với ba ...
Mawg

5
@Mawg Chà, họ sẽ đặt bản sao thứ ba ở đâu? Đầu đĩa và cuối đĩa là những vị trí rõ ràng không gây rối với bất cứ thứ gì và không có khả năng bị hỏng cùng một lúc, nhưng bạn không thể đặt một bó dữ liệu vào giữa đĩa.
Luaan

1
@Mawg: chào bạn, đặt bản sao thứ ba vào giữa các khu vực đĩa sẽ buộc bạn phải phân chia phân vùng ở đó. Trong trường hợp này, bạn sẽ không thể di chuyển hoặc thu nhỏ phân vùng qua dòng đó (ý tôi là khu vực LBA :). Vì vậy, đó là không thực tế. Và nếu bạn đặt cái thứ 3 gần cái thứ 1 hoặc thứ 2, thì khả năng làm hỏng tất cả các bản sao gần như giữ nguyên, IMHO.
saulius2

9
@Mawg Hãy nhớ rằng mỗi bản sao có một tổng kiểm tra CRC, do đó, nó sẽ cho bạn biết bản sao nào trong hai bản sao bị hỏng ...
Toán

2
@Mawg bạn đang tìm kiếm một giải pháp cho một vấn đề giả định. Nếu hai bảng GPT không khớp nhau và nếu tổng kiểm tra CRC32 của chúng đều ổn, thì bạn thực sự có vấn đề bạn đang mô tả. Điều này thực tế sẽ chỉ xảy ra do một lỗi nghiêm trọng trong hệ điều hành. Có tính đến những nhược điểm và vấn đề với bản sao GPT thứ ba (tôi nghĩ bạn có thể đánh giá thấp cách phân vùng phức tạp có thể có trong môi trường máy chủ), cũng như hồi quy về chức năng, tôi có thể tưởng tượng rằng các nhà thiết kế đã chọn không phải hạt nhân- tùy chọn bảo vệ :)
mtak
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.